Somalia: Al Shabaab claims raid on Bossaso police compound

Image

BOSSASO, Somalia, April 18, 2015 (Garowe Online)-Somalia’s Al Qaeda linked Al Shabaab group claimed credit for raid on police compound in the Gulf of Aden port city of Bossaso, Garowe Online reports.

In a statement released online, the militant group said at least three of their fighters targeted Balade police station in New Bossaso neighborhood with rocket propelled grenades.

Meanwhile, Bari regional police commander Abdihakin Yusuf Hussein said on VOA Somali service that station commander sustained minor injuries in the attack.

Al Shabaab claims come two months after similar assault left a soldier wounded, and pick-up truck destroyed at Balade police compound.

Militants honed military-style ambushes and night raids in Puntland’s most populous city, Bossaso.

The port city has been grappling with large influx of migrants fleeing from Yemen civil war.

Puntland Defence Forces and Al Shabaab fighters fought in sporadic battles in the rugged terrain of Galgala and hideouts along Golis Mountain ranges.

Analysts believe that joint military campaign by African Union peacekeepers and Somali government forces in central and southern Somalia forced Al Shabaab remnants to migrate northwards towards Puntland.
